How they compare

Mali currently reports 15.8% against 15.7% in Syrian Arab Republic,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Syrian Arab Republic ahead.

Mali ranks 134th and Syrian Arab Republic ranks 136th of 178 countries.

Syrian Arab Republic has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Gross savings are the difference between gross national income and public and private consumption, plus net current transfers.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of Gross National Income (GNI) which is the total income earned by all residents within an economic territory during an accounting period. It is equal to gross domestic product plus earned income receivable from abroad minus earned income payable abroad.
